Subject: [PATCH 21/29] mac_scsi: Convert to platform device
Date: Thu, 02 Oct 2014 16:56:49 +1000 [thread overview]
Message-ID: <20141002065633.296184897@telegraphics.com.au> (raw)
In-Reply-To: 20141002065628.256592712@telegraphics.com.au
[-- Attachment #1: mac_scsi-convert-to-platform-device --]
[-- Type: text/plain, Size: 17768 bytes --]
Convert mac_scsi to platform device and eliminate scsi_register().
Platform resources for chip registers now follow the documentation. This
should fix issues with the Mac IIci (and possibly other models too).
Signed-off-by: Finn Thain <fthain@telegraphics.com.au>
---
The new hwreg_present() call is not protected by local_irq_save/restore.
This assumes Geert's patch, "Disable/restore interrupts in
hwreg_present()/hwreg_write()":
http://marc.info/?l=linux-kernel&m=141189640826704&w=2

+static int __init mac_scsi_probe(struct platform_device *pdev)
+{
+ struct Scsi_Host *instance;
+ int error;
+ int host_flags = 0;
+ struct resource *irq, *pio_mem, *pdma_mem = NULL;
+
+ if (!MACH_IS_MAC)
+ return -ENODEV;
+
+ pio_mem = platform_get_resource(pdev, IORESOURCE_MEM, 0);
+ if (!pio_mem)
+ return -ENODEV;
+
+#ifdef PSEUDO_DMA
+ pdma_mem = platform_get_resource(pdev, IORESOURCE_MEM, 1);
+#endif
+
+ irq = platform_get_resource(pdev, IORESOURCE_IRQ, 0);
+
+ if (!hwreg_present((unsigned char *)pio_mem->start +
+ (STATUS_REG << 4))) {
+ pr_info(PFX "no device detected at %pap\n", &pio_mem->start);
+ return -ENODEV;
+ }
+
+ if (setup_can_queue > 0)
+ mac_scsi_template.can_queue = setup_can_queue;
+ if (setup_cmd_per_lun > 0)
+ mac_scsi_template.cmd_per_lun = setup_cmd_per_lun;
+ if (setup_sg_tablesize >= 0)
+ mac_scsi_template.sg_tablesize = setup_sg_tablesize;
+ if (setup_hostid >= 0)
+ mac_scsi_template.this_id = setup_hostid & 7;
+#ifdef SUPPORT_TAGS
+ if (setup_use_tagged_queuing < 0)
+ setup_use_tagged_queuing = 0;
+#endif
+ if (setup_use_pdma < 0)
+ setup_use_pdma = 0;
+
+ instance = scsi_host_alloc(&mac_scsi_template,
+ sizeof(struct NCR5380_hostdata));
+ if (!instance)
+ return -ENOMEM;
+
+ instance->base = pio_mem->start;
+ if (irq)
+ instance->irq = irq->start;
+ else
+ instance->irq = IRQ_NONE;
+
+ if (pdma_mem && setup_use_pdma) {
+ struct NCR5380_hostdata *hostdata = shost_priv(instance);
+
+ hostdata->pdma_base = (unsigned char *)pdma_mem->start;
+ } else
+ host_flags |= FLAG_NO_PSEUDO_DMA;
+
+#ifdef RESET_BOOT
+ mac_scsi_reset_boot(instance);
+#endif
+
+ NCR5380_init(instance, host_flags);
+
+ if (instance->irq != IRQ_NONE) {
+ error = request_irq(instance->irq, macscsi_intr, 0,
+ "NCR5380", instance);
+ if (error)
+ goto fail_irq;
+ }
+
+ error = scsi_add_host(instance, NULL);
+ if (error)
+ goto fail_host;
+
+ platform_set_drvdata(pdev, instance);
+
+ scsi_scan_host(instance);
+ return 0;
+
+fail_host:
+ if (instance->irq != IRQ_NONE)
+ free_irq(instance->irq, instance);
+fail_irq:
+ NCR5380_exit(instance);
+ scsi_host_put(instance);
+ return error;
+}
+
+static int __exit mac_scsi_remove(struct platform_device *pdev)
+{
+ struct Scsi_Host *instance = platform_get_drvdata(pdev);
+
+ scsi_remove_host(instance);
+ if (instance->irq != IRQ_NONE)
+ free_irq(instance->irq, instance);
+ NCR5380_exit(instance);
+ scsi_host_put(instance);
+ return 0;
+}
+
+static struct platform_driver mac_scsi_driver = {
+ .remove = __exit_p(mac_scsi_remove),
+ .driver = {
+ .name = DRV_MODULE_NAME,
+ .owner = THIS_MODULE,
+ },
+};
-#include "scsi_module.c"
+module_platform_driver_probe(mac_scsi_driver, mac_scsi_probe);
+MODULE_ALIAS("platform:" DRV_MODULE_NAME);
MODULE_LICENSE("GPL");

@@ -1000,6 +1030,53 @@ int __init mac_platform_init(void)
(macintosh_config->ident == MAC_MODEL_Q950))
platform_device_register(&esp_1_pdev);
break;
+ case MAC_SCSI_IIFX:
+ /* Addresses from The Guide to Mac Family Hardware. */
+ mac_scsi_0_rsrc[1].start = 0x50008000; /* SCSI DMA */
+ mac_scsi_0_rsrc[1].end = mac_scsi_0_rsrc[1].start + 0x1FFF;
+ /* $5000 E000 - $5000 FFFF: Alternate SCSI (Hsk) */
+ /* $5000 C000 - $5000 DFFF: Alternate SCSI (DMA) */
+ /* The SCSI DMA custom IC embeds the 53C80 core. mac_scsi does
+ * not make use of its DMA or hardware handshaking logic.
+ */
+ mac_scsi_0_pdev.num_resources--;
+ platform_device_register(&mac_scsi_0_pdev);
+ break;
+ case MAC_SCSI_DUO:
+ /* Addresses from the Duo Dock II Developer Note. */
+ mac_scsi_1_rsrc[0].start = 0xFEE02000; /* normal mode */
+ mac_scsi_1_rsrc[0].end = mac_scsi_1_rsrc[0].start + 0x1FFF;
+ mac_scsi_1_rsrc[1].start = 0xFEE06000;/* pseudo DMA with /DRQ */
+ mac_scsi_1_rsrc[1].end = mac_scsi_1_rsrc[1].start + 0x1FFF;
+ /* $FEE0 4000 - $FEE0 5FFF: pseudo DMA without /DRQ */
+ platform_device_register(&mac_scsi_1_pdev);
+ /* fall through */
+ case MAC_SCSI_OLD:
+ /* Addresses from Developer Notes for Duo System,
+ * PowerBook 180 & 160, 140 & 170, Macintosh IIsi
+ * and also from The Guide to Mac Family Hardware for
+ * SE/30, II, IIx, IIcx, IIci.
+ * GMFH says that $5000 0000 - $50FF FFFF "wraps
+ * $5000 0000 - $5001 FFFF eight times"...
+ * mess.org says IIci and Color Classic do not alias
+ * I/O address space.
+ */
+ mac_scsi_0_rsrc[1].start = 0x50010000; /* normal mode */
+ mac_scsi_0_rsrc[1].end = mac_scsi_0_rsrc[1].start + 0x1FFF;
+ mac_scsi_0_rsrc[2].start = 0x50006000;/* pseudo DMA with /DRQ */
+ mac_scsi_0_rsrc[2].end = mac_scsi_0_rsrc[2].start + 0x1FFF;
+ /* $5001 2000 - $5001 3FFF: pseudo DMA without /DRQ */
+ platform_device_register(&mac_scsi_0_pdev);
+ break;
+ case MAC_SCSI_CCL:
+ /* Addresses from the Color Classic Developer Note. */
+ mac_scsi_0_rsrc[1].start = 0x50F10000; /* SCSI */
+ mac_scsi_0_rsrc[1].end = mac_scsi_0_rsrc[1].start + 0x1FFF;
+ mac_scsi_0_rsrc[2].start = 0x50F06000; /* SCSI handshake */
+ mac_scsi_0_rsrc[2].end = mac_scsi_0_rsrc[2].start + 0x1FFF;
+ /* $50F1 2000 - $50F1 3FFF: SCSI DMA */
+ platform_device_register(&mac_scsi_0_pdev);
+ break;
}
